I urge Nigerians abroad not to tarnish the image of the country, Abike Dabiri reacts to Hushpuppi’s arrest
Chairman of the Nigerians in the Diaspora Commission, Abike Dabiri-Erewa whilst reacting to the arrest of Hushpuppi has urged Nigerians not to judge those succeeding abroad.
Recall that popular Instagram figure Ramoni Igbalode a.k.a Ray Hushpuppi was arrested on charges bordering on internet fraud and other related activities.
Reacting to his arrest on Twitter, Abike Dabiri stated that the allegations against Hushpuppi is not a yardstick to judge other Nigerians excelling outside the country.
She went on to urge Nigerians abroad to be law-abiding citizens, good ambassadors and not tarnish the image of the country, while also asking Nigerians to await EFCC’s thorough investigation as well as further updates on the case.
She wrote;
“RE- RAY HUSHPUPPI (Ramoni Igbalode) HAS A CASE TO ANSWER WITH EFCC. The Nigerians in Diaspora Commission notes with displeasure, the cyber crime and money laundering network/transaction running into millions of dollars allegedly exhibited by Ramoni Igbalode aka Ray Hushpuppi.
We await @officialEFCC’s further and thorough investigation as well as further updates on the case. We advise and urge Nigerians abroad to be law-abiding citizens, be good ambassadors and not tarnish the image of the country.
However, while a few Nigerians get involved in acts such as this, millions of others are excelling world over. One bad apple should not spoil the whole bunch!.”
